Join Us in Cheadle (Manchester, UK): You will join a successful team of Technical Support Engineers providing first class support to our customers utilising a variety of remote diagnostic tools. Your primary role will be troubleshooting and resolving software issues on customer’s Client/Server and Standalone PC configurations. This will require troubleshooting of PC network communication, instrument control, data analysis and database issues as well as using virtualization software to reproduce problems in-house. You will also be required to provide support on our instrumentation so experience with analytical techniques is required. You will occasionally be required to visit customer sites for installations, repairs and scheduled services.
